CI note for on-call: the map-tile prefetcher in Wayfern's pipeline fails its smoke test whenever the synthetic region set includes the Kellbrook coastline fixtures. Root cause is a zoom-level mismatch between the fixture manifest and the prefetch config — tiles at z14 are requested but the fixture only ships z12. Workaround: pin the fixture bundle to the prior revision and rerun. A proper fix is tracked in the Wayfern backlog. The failing run's trace token follows below.

trace token, fafog-kageg: htk4_98e6

BRIEFING — Leadership Review

Topic: Supplier Contract Renewal, Merrow Components Ltd.

The Merrow contract expires at quarter end. Pricing proposals show a 6% increase, partly offset by improved delivery terms. Alternatives were assessed but carry switching costs and qualification delays. Procurement recommends a two-year renewal with a mid-term review clause. The confidential note below outlines how this fits our broader plans.

board note of fahog-bawep: The renewal with Holixax Holdings closes at $20 million a year, 20 percent below the last contract. Project Druwyn slips by two quarters because of the supplier delay.

## Changelog — Fennel DB 4.2.1

Reverted planner default introduced in 4.2.0 after a regression caused full scans on partitioned audit tables, inflating log-read volume and masking anomaly detection. No privilege or exposure impact identified. Defaults now match 4.1 behavior; the override flag remains but is discouraged. Review the shipped defaults below before signing off.

config for kafof-bawef:
holath:
  log_level: debug
  metrics_host: metrics.holath.qorvelsys.internal
  pin: 2191
  pool_size: 32

The Pinwheel loyalty-points ledger is append-only; never edit rows directly. Adjustments go through the correction queue, which posts an offsetting entry and links both records. If balances look wrong, first confirm the nightly reconciliation job finished before escalating. Most discrepancies clear on the next run. The reconciliation schedule and recent run logs live on the page below.

wiki page, tahaf-tajog: https://jira.ordindyn.corp/pipeline